if guess==1: print("玩家出【石头】") elif guess==2: print("玩家出【剪刀】") elif guess==3: print("玩家出【布】") import random computer=random.randint(1,3) if computer==1: print("电脑出【石头】") elif computer==2: print("电脑出【剪刀】") elif computer==3: print("电脑出【...
computer=random.randint(1,3) user=int(input('请出拳:1/拳头,2/剪刀,3/布')) ifcomputer==1: computer='拳头' elifcomputer==2: computer='剪刀' else: computer='布' ifuser==1: user='拳头' elifuser==2: user='剪刀' else: user='布' print('电脑人出的是%s,用户出的是%s'%(computer,...
步骤1:导入随机模块 首先,我们需要导入Python的随机模块,以便让电脑能够随机选择剪刀、石头或布。 importrandom 1. 步骤2:定义游戏循环 接下来,我们需要定义一个游戏循环,使游戏可以一直进行下去,直到玩家选择退出。 whileTrue:# 游戏代码将放在这里pass 1. 2. 3. 步骤3:玩家选择 在游戏循环中,我们需要让玩家输入...
import random # 定义剪刀、石头、布的选项 options = ["剪刀", "石头", "布"] # 定义胜利条...
Com=random.randint(0,2)print(Com)Human=input("请输入(石头、剪刀或布):")print(Human)if Human==list[Com]:print('平局,再来!')continue elif Human=='石头' and list[Com]=='剪刀':print('你赢了,恭喜你!')break elif ...
python代码如何用类编写剪刀石头布 ython代码如何用类编写剪刀石头布 使用类完成石头剪刀布 1:角色选择 2:角色出拳 3:电脑出拳 4:人机对战,统计二十回合内的积分(角色胜多少局,电脑胜多少局,平局多少?) 1:角色选择 2:角色出拳 3:电脑出拳 4:人机对战,统计二十回合内的积分(角色胜多少局,电脑胜多少局,平局...
展开阅读全文
原题链接:蓝桥杯算法提高VIP-剪刀石头布 直接Python打表玩考虑每一种情况,直接用一个字典解决 import math ans={ "0 0":0, "1 1":0, "2 2":0, "0 1":-1, "1 2":-1, "2 0":-1, "1 0":1, "2 1":1, "0 2":1, } inp=input() print(ans.get(inp)) 这题目也就图个开心了 ...
python代码如何用类编写剪刀石头布( 使用类完成石头剪刀布 1:角色选择 2:角色出拳 3:电脑出拳 4:人机对战,统计二十回合内的积分(角色胜多少局,电脑胜多少局,平局多少? 一、角色选择 二、角色出拳 三、电脑出拳 四、人机对战,统计二十回合内的积分(角色胜多少局,电脑胜多少局,平局多少?